A perfect game and a rally from six runs down were among the highlights from Wednesday's softball action.

Mechanicsburg 16, Gettysburg 10 (10 inn.)

The Wildcats scored six times in the top of the 10th inning, while relief pitcher Maddie Garrick retired the last 14 batters she faced for the win. Kirstie Shay was 4-for-7 for Mechanicsburg.
Mifflin County 13, Carlisle 3 (5 inn.)

Allessa Morrison hit two triples for the Huskies in this mercy rule win over the Thundering Herd.
Central Dauphin 10, Red Land 4

Carlee Gochenauer had two hits and two RBIs for the Rams. Madi Christiansen had a solo home run for the Patriots.
Annville-Cleona 8, Lancaster Catholic 7

After the Crusaders scored five runs in the top of the sixth to tie the game 6-6, the Dutchmen scored in the bottom of the seventh for a walk-off victory.
State College 7, Williamsport 6
Laura Harris' RBI single in the bottom of the ninth drove in Liz Drawl for the game-winning run. The Little Lions traield 6-2 after the top of the second.
Cumberland Valley 14, Chambersburg 2 (5 inn.)

Rachel Mumma and Jess Moore both homered for the Eagles. Zoe St. Cyr had three hits including a triple in the win.
Manheim Twp. 6, Cedar Crest 3
A three-run home run by Kathleen Zogorski in the bottom of the first inning set the tone for the Blue Streaks. Katie Ford had a triple and RBI for Cedar Crest.
Upper Dauphin 1, Millersburg 0 (8 inn.)
Amber Bingaman singled and scored on an outfield error in the top of the eighth inning to score the game-winning run for the Trojans. Bingaman also struck out 15 Millersburg batters. Marlo Roadcap struck out 10 batters in defeat.
Juniata 10, Line Mountain 7

Juniata rallied back after trailing 7-1 after two innings. Summer Swab hit three doubles and drove in three runs for Juniata in the comeback.
Elco 4, Northern Lebanon 2

Maddie Drescher had a double and two RBIs for the Raiders in this victory over the Vikings. Elco scored three runs in the bottom of the fourth to take a 4-0 lead.
Lampeter-Strasburg 2, Donegal 0

Jordan Weaver pitched her second straight perfect game for the Pioneers, striking out 15 Donegal batters.
